## v2.8.1

Fixed encoding detection for uploaded text files in Parchmint. UTF-16 files without a BOM were previously misread as Latin-1, corrupting imports. Detection now samples the first 8 KB and falls back to UTF-8 only when confidence is low. No schema changes; safe to ship in the regular train. Direct questions about this change to the engineer below.

named custodian: Brivan Eliath Quenox Frador

Memo to Heads of Department

Quick heads-up: we're in early talks to acquire Tindercroft Analytics. Nothing is signed, and it may not happen, so keep this within your leadership circles. If it proceeds, integration planning would start in the autumn, led from the Moorgreave office. Don't make staffing changes in anticipation. The confidential outline of intentions follows below.

management briefing: Project Ulavan slips by two quarters because of the staffing delay.

Handover — Brask to Edlund

Logistics switch: we drop Corvane Freight end of month, move to Helgar Transit. Sales leads should quote Helgar delivery windows from the 1st — two days faster to coastal accounts. Open Corvane claims stay with me until closure. Edlund takes carrier reviews. No customer announcement yet. Read the following before briefing your teams.

management briefing: The pricing group signed off on a budget of $378.8 million for Project Kasael.

Subject: Handover — validator plugin stuff

Hey Priya,

Passing you the baton on Checkwright, our plugin system for data validators. The new schema-drift plugin shipped Tuesday and mostly behaves, but it occasionally flags empty CSV uploads as "malformed" — harmless, just noisy. I've muted the alert until Friday. If support escalates anything about plugin load failures, the fix is usually bumping the registry cache. Questions after I'm off? Reach the Checkwright maintainers at the address below.

billing contact of hawip-kahif = zorwyn@tolvaqlabs.corp

**Vendor note: Tickfield cron drift**

Quick heads-up for the security review: our scheduling vendor Tickfield has been drifting job start times by up to four minutes on their shared tier, which briefly overlapped our credential-rotation window last week. No compromise suspected, but the overlap meant stale tokens lived longer than our policy allows. Tickfield says a fix lands next cycle; we've asked for their incident write-up. If you want the raw timing logs or the vendor correspondence, just ask the platform liaison.

escalation mailbox, fafof-bahip: tamael@ordincorp.test